[超声检测羊水中胎儿胎脂作为胎儿成熟度的一项指标]

[Ultrasonic detection of fetal vernix in amniotic fluid as and index to fetal maturity].

作者信息

Sepúlveda W H, Araneda H, Avendaño A

机构信息

Servicio de Obstetricia y Ginecología, Hospital Clínico Regional Guillermo Grant Benavente, Universidad de Concepción.

出版信息

Rev Chil Obstet Ginecol. 1991;56(1):43-7.

PMID:1844600
Abstract

The relationship between ultrasonographic detection of fetal vernix and visual assessment of amniotic fluid (AF) and fetal pulmonary maturity evaluated by the "shake test" was studied in 73 high-risk patients undergoing amniocentesis for obstetrical indications. The AF was classified as type I, type II, and type III, depending on the subjective amount of vernix detected. Ultrasound predicted correctly 7 out of 11 cases of type I AF (64%), 14 out of 22 cases of type II AF (64%), and 38 out of 40 cases of type III AF (95%). When ultrasonography detected type I AF the "shake test" was negative in all cases, whereas if type II or type III were found, the "shake test" was positive in 40% and 86%, respectively. Our results suggest that sonographic detection of type I AF is associated with immaturity, thus amniocentesis should be avoided in such cases. Conversely, if a type III AF is detected a mature fetus is found in almost 90% of the cases. The observation of AF detecting fetal vernix during third trimester sonography is a simple manoeuver that can help to avoid the use of amniocentesis, an invasive procedure associated with some serious fetal and maternal complications.

摘要

在73例因产科指征接受羊膜穿刺术的高危患者中,研究了超声检测胎儿胎脂与羊水(AF)视觉评估以及通过“摇晃试验”评估的胎儿肺成熟度之间的关系。根据检测到的胎脂主观量,将羊水分为I型、II型和III型。超声正确预测出11例I型羊水病例中的7例(64%)、22例II型羊水病例中的14例(64%)以及40例III型羊水病例中的38例(95%)。当超声检测到I型羊水时,所有病例的“摇晃试验”均为阴性,而如果发现II型或III型羊水,“摇晃试验”的阳性率分别为40%和86%。我们的结果表明,超声检测到I型羊水与不成熟相关,因此在这种情况下应避免进行羊膜穿刺术。相反,如果检测到III型羊水,几乎90%的病例中胎儿是成熟的。在孕晚期超声检查中观察羊水检测胎儿胎脂是一种简单的操作,可以帮助避免使用羊膜穿刺术,这是一种与一些严重胎儿和母体并发症相关的侵入性手术。
